Villkora is a Swedish verb meaning to impose conditions or terms on someone or something, or to subject something to predefined prerequisites. It is used to describe the act of attaching covenants, restrictions, or requirements to an agreement, contract, loan, lease, or license. In everyday usage, villkora implies a formal or contractual conditioning rather than a casual restriction.
